TEWKSBURY, MA — Police arrested a Tewksbury man who allegedly had brandished a large knife Tuesday, Tewksbury police said.
Christopher Canty, 49 of Tewksbury, was charged with assault with a dangerous weapon (knife), disorderly conduct, and threat to commit murder.
Police were sent to the 700 block of Shawsheen Street a report of a man possibly brandishing a large knife. When they arrived, they learned the knife had been discarded, police said, but after further investigation, the knife was found.
"During the investigation, Canty displayed erratic and highly agitated behavior," police said. "Officers were able to safely take him into custody and he was placed under arrest."
Canty was scheduled to be arraigned in Lowell District Court Wednesday.
All people are presumed innocent until proven guilty.
